Transaction 222e568436ed7728258103627e2dfe7a3bf36eec30d573cdc1820443faee3b6d

2 Input
2 Outputs
  • 222e568436ed7728258103627e2dfe7a3bf36eec30d573cdc1820443faee3b6d:0
  • value  5765370
    address  3JbDRh9uKcyjSMYsP8B98to9PXbWhEMJS3
  • 222e568436ed7728258103627e2dfe7a3bf36eec30d573cdc1820443faee3b6d:1
  • value  2012149
    address  bc1qxg32y6cfn40hcl6meyc6athvjkntgmgk7syr3l